Hydrophilic PES Membrane Filters: Performance and Applications

Polyethersulfone membrane filters offer a significant advantage in filtration processes due to their inherent hydrophilic nature. This property reduces biofouling and maintains consistent permeability compared to hydrophobic alternatives. Their excellent chemical resistance and thermal stability enable application in a wide range of industries, including biotech production, water treatment, and food and beverage processing. Specific uses span from sterile filtration of cell culture broth to prefiltration for reverse osmosis click here systems, demonstrating their versatility and broad applicability.
